Even prior to COVID-19, the competition for team members who can serve our customers to our high standards was intense. That competition has intensified as many people re-evaluated their career priorities and employment desires during the pandemic. Businesses everywhere are extremely short staffed, to the point of affecting their operations.  

Like many small businesses, New Market Bank doesn’t have pockets as deep as big corporations that can offer top dollar to lure someone to work for them. We need to be creative and leverage our strengths as a family-owned, community bank to compete for team members just like we do for customers. We have spent years intentionally cultivating a workplace that is attractive to potential team members, helping them feel valued day-in and day-out. 

We know our strength lies in our relationships with our communities, our customers and our team members. We strive to create a company culture and atmosphere in each of three locations that feel like family. There is camaraderie and familiarity. There is mutual respect. There is commitment to helping resolve problems. 

We also know many prospective team members, especially those who were born and raised in the area, appreciate our support and involvement in our local communities. New Market Bank invests in our communities through participation in local civic and business organizations and our “Giving Back to the Community Program,” which in 2020 totaled nearly $30,000.

Many prospective team members find us because we’re close to home. While there are certainly many people who aspire to climb the corporate ladder, we’re finding more and more people who value short commutes, free parking and a more flexible, laid-back workplace. That’s what they’ll find at many small businesses. 

In addition to the less tangible benefits to team members, we’ve worked hard to develop and refine our training program to help employees grasp daily responsibilities as well as the priority we place on relationships and mutual respect. We offer a Health Savings Account that is matched 1:1 up to $1,000 for the employee and $2,000 for family. Our Personal Time Off (PTO benefits) including regular PTO, Purchased PTO and a PTO Donation Bank, which can help team members in need.

These practices have paid off. We have 8 team members who have been with us for 10 years or more. The Dakota-Scott Workforce Development Board also recently named New Market Bank one of 10 Employers of Excellence for 2021, based on the results of a 40-question survey of our employee retention, compensation and training practices.

I’m extremely proud of this award because it reflects the results of years of intentional planning and hard work. It indicates our team members approve of our hiring and training practices and appreciate the culture we’ve nurtured for more than 100 years.
